Hirdetés

Új hozzászólás Aktív témák

  • t181
    senior tag

    Még egy kérdés:
    ViewPager-ben van egy olyan, hogy setOffScreenPageLimit()
    Ez vajon el is tünteti a felesleges Fragmenteket/View-kat, vagy csak LEGALÁBB ennyit betölt előre?
    Mert a log alapján az egyszer létrehozott fragmantek nem szűnnek meg soha. (Mármint megszűnnek persze, de nem a ViewPager miatt)
    Pontosítok:
    Lefut a pause, stop és destroyview; de a destroy nem.

    Más:
    Az Android Studioban hol lehet beállítani, hogy a support könyvtárakban lévő metódusokról is (mint pl a setOffScreenPageLimit) adjon ki dokumentációs leírást?

    Nem feltétlenül probléma, hogy az onDestroy nem fut le. onDestroyView-ban ugye szétszedi a View-t és sok referenciát elenged (pl leiratkozik az Observer-ekről). Profiler-rel figyeld a memóriahasználatot, abból kiderül, hogy okoz-e galibát a sok Fragment.

    "Pontosan ezért nem szerettem volna minden ablaknak külön háttérszálat nyitni."

    Hogy használod a háttérszálakat? Hogy hozod létre őket? Mire használod?

Új hozzászólás Aktív témák